摘要
The Raman and Infrared (IR) spectra of poly(methyl methacrylate) (PMMA) membranes plasticized by ionic liquids of the (1-x)[1-butyl-3-methylimidazolium bis(trifluoromethanesulfonyl)imide (BMITFSI)],xLiTFSI type, where BMI+ is the 1-butyl-3-methylimidazolium cation and TFSI- the bis(trifluoromethanesulfonyl)imide anion, are analyzed for a lithium bis(trifluoromethane sulfone)imide (LiTFSI) mole fraction x = 0.23 and PMMA contents from 0 to 50 wt%. The lithium is found to have an average coordination of about three C=O groups and less than one TFSI- anion. It plays the role of a cross-linker between the ester groups of PMMA and the nonvolatile ionic liquid. Addition of PMMA to the (1 - x)(BMITFSI),xLiTFSI ionic liquid lowers the conductivity but might improve the lithium transference number by transforming the [Li(TFSI)(2)](-) anionic clusters present in the pure ionic liquid into a mixed coordination by ester groups and TFSI- anions.
